In the world of marketing, promotion techniques refer to various strategies and tactics used by businesses to promote their products or services to a target market. These techniques are designed to increase awareness, interest, and demand for a company's offering, ultimately resulting in increased sales and revenue.
Some of the most popular promotion techniques include discounts and coupons, product bundling, free samples and trials, contests and sweepstakes, and event marketing. Each technique has its own unique advantages and disadvantages, depending on the business goals and target market.

Discounts and coupons are powerful promotion techniques that offer customers a financial incentive to purchase a product or service. By offering discounts or coupons on their products, businesses can attract new customers and retain existing ones.
To create an effective discount or coupon campaign, businesses should consider their target audience, the discount amount or percentage off, the duration of the promotion, and any restrictions or limitations that apply.

Product bundling involves combining several products or services into a single package at a discounted price. This promotion technique is useful for businesses looking to increase average order value by encouraging customers to purchase more items at once.
To create an effective product bundle, businesses should consider which products complement each other well, what price point is most attractive to customers, and how much margin they can afford to sacrifice for the bundle discount.

Free samples and trials allow customers to try a product or service before they commit to a purchase. This promotion technique can be especially effective for products that customers may be hesitant to try or that have a high price point.
To create an effective free sample or trial campaign, businesses should consider which products are most suited for sampling, how to distribute the samples effectively, and how to incentivize customers to make a purchase after trying the product.

Contests and sweepstakes involve offering customers the chance to win a prize in exchange for entering a competition. This promotion technique is effective for businesses looking to generate excitement around their brand or new product launch.
To create an effective contest or sweepstakes campaign, businesses should consider what prize will be most attractive to their target audience, how to promote the contest effectively, and what rules and regulations need to be in place.

Event marketing involves promoting a product or service at a live event such as a trade show or festival. This promotion technique is useful for businesses looking to get face-to-face with potential customers.
To create an effective event marketing campaign, businesses should consider the audience and location of the event, what marketing materials will be needed, and how to collect leads or make sales at the event.
